About FDDI
Established:
FDDI was established in 1986 under the aegis of the Ministry of Commerce and Industry, Government of India .Location:
FDDI has 12 campuses across IndiaHeritage:
With its establishment in 1986, FDDI boasts nearly four decades of experience in footwear, leather, and fashion education.Mission & Vision:
- Mission: To provide globally benchmarked education and promote research, innovation, and entrepreneurship in the domains of design, technology, retail, and management.
Vision: To establish India as a leading hub for design, technology, retail, and management by creating quality infrastructure and support systems for the industry
Integrity:
FDDI emphasizes strong values and ethics as integral components of its institutional philosophy, aiming to instill these principles in its students and faculty.

Accreditations & Rankings
Accreditations
Recognized as an Institution of National Importance (INI) under the FDDI Act, 2017.
Affiliated with Ministry of Commerce & Industry, Government of India.
UGC-approved degrees under the FDDI Act.
Programs accredited by relevant industry bodies and approved by AICTE (for applicable technical programs).
ISO 9001 certified for quality management systems.

Courses Offered: FDDI
Undergraduate Programs
Program | Duration | Eligibility Criteria | Admission Process |
---|---|---|---|
B.Des. (Footwear Design & Production) | 4 years | 10+2 (any stream) from a recognized board | CUET UG score + Counselling |
B.Des. (Fashion Design) | 4 years | 10+2 (any stream) from a recognized board | CUET UG score + Counselling |
B.Des. (Leather Goods & Accessories Design) | 4 years | 10+2 (any stream) from a recognized board | CUET UG score + Counselling |
B.Des. (Fashion Merchandising & Communication) | 4 years | 10+2 (any stream) from a recognized board | CUET UG score + Counselling |
BBA (Retail & Fashion Merchandise) | 3 years | 10+2 (any stream) from a recognized board | CUET UG score + Counselling |
Postgraduate Programs
Program | Duration | Eligibility Criteria | Admission Process |
---|---|---|---|
MBA (Retail & Fashion Merchandise) | 2 years | Bachelor’s degree in any discipline with at least 50% marks (45% for reserved categories) | CUET PG score + Counselling |
MBA (Footwear Production & Management) | 2 years | Bachelor’s degree in any discipline with at least 50% marks (45% for reserved categories) | CUET PG score + Counselling |
MBA (Fashion Merchandising & Management) | 2 years | Bachelor’s degree in any discipline with at least 50% marks (45% for reserved categories) | CUET PG score + Counselling |
Doctoral Programs
Program | Duration | Eligibility Criteria | Admission Process |
---|---|---|---|
PhD in Design (Footwear, Fashion, and Leather Goods) | 3 to 5 years | Master’s degree in Design, Fashion, Footwear, or related field with a minimum of 55% marks | Entrance exam (FDDI) + Interview |
PhD in Management (Retail, Fashion, and Footwear) | 3 to 5 years | Master’s degree in Management or related field with a minimum of 55% marks | Entrance exam (FDDI) + Interview |

Scholarship Opportunities : FDDI
Merit-Based Scholarships:
Offered to students based on academic performance in the entrance exam (CUET UG/PG) and during the course.
Scholarships cover up to 50% of tuition fees for top-performing students.
Government Scholarship Schemes:
Central Government Scholarships: For SC, ST, OBC, and minority students under various schemes (e.g., Post-Matric Scholarship, National Merit Scholarship).
State Government Scholarships: Available for students belonging to specific states, including SC/ST/OBC and economically disadvantaged categories.
FDDI-specific Scholarships:
Scholarships for students from economically weaker sections (EWS) to promote education in the footwear and fashion industries.
Special scholarships for meritorious students applying for MBA programs based on entrance exam performance.
Industry Partner Scholarships:
Scholarships offered by industry partners like Bata, Adidas, and Reliance Retail for students pursuing design and fashion-related courses.
These scholarships may include internships and placement opportunities.
Need-Based Financial Assistance:
Available for students facing financial hardships. The financial assistance is provided based on family income and other criteria.
Sports and Cultural Scholarships:
Offered to students excelling in sports or cultural activities, promoting holistic development.
